Comprehensive Vermiculite Removal and Disposal
Vermiculite insulation removal is a specialized process often required due to health concerns and building regulations. This type of insulation, historically used in attics and walls, can contain asbestos fibers, making professional removal essential for safety and compliance.

Vermiculite insulation was widely used due to its fire-resistant properties and ease of installation. However, concerns about asbestos contamination have led to increased demand for professional removal services. The process involves careful containment, removal, and disposal, adhering to strict safety standards.

The duration of vermiculite removal varies depending on the size of the area and the complexity of the job. Typically, a professional team can complete removal within one to three days, ensuring thorough and safe extraction.
